14 changes: 13 additions & 1 deletion docs/configuration.asciidoc
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-90,8 +90,20 @@ _Default:_ `false`
_Default:_ `null`

|`agent`
|`http.AgentOptions` - http agent https://nodejs.org/api/http.html#http_new_agent_options[options]. +
a|`http.AgentOptions, function` - http agent https://nodejs.org/api/http.html#http_new_agent_options[options], or a function that returns an actual http agent instance. +
_Default:_ `null`
[source,js]
----
const client = new Client({
node: 'http://localhost:9200',
agent: { agent: 'options' }
})

const client = new Client({
node: 'http://localhost:9200',
agent: () => new CustomAgent()
})
----
